  24 /*
  25  * @test
  26  * @bug 6306829
  27  * @summary Verify assertions in get() javadocs
  28  * @author Martin Buchholz
  29  */
  30 
  31 import java.util.HashMap;
  32 import java.util.Hashtable;
  33 import java.util.IdentityHashMap;
  34 import java.util.LinkedHashMap;
  35 import java.util.Map;
  36 import java.util.Objects;
  37 import java.util.SortedMap;
  38 import java.util.TreeMap;
  39 import java.util.WeakHashMap;
  40 import java.util.concurrent.ConcurrentHashMap;
  41 import java.util.concurrent.ConcurrentMap;
  42 import java.util.concurrent.ConcurrentSkipListMap;
  43 
  44 public class Get {
  45 
  46     private static void realMain(String[] args) throws Throwable {
  47         testMap(new Hashtable<Character,Boolean>());
  48         testMap(new HashMap<Character,Boolean>());
  49         testMap(new IdentityHashMap<Character,Boolean>());
  50         testMap(new LinkedHashMap<Character,Boolean>());
  51         testMap(new ConcurrentHashMap<Character,Boolean>());
  52         testMap(new WeakHashMap<Character,Boolean>());
  53         testMap(new TreeMap<Character,Boolean>());
  54         testMap(new ConcurrentSkipListMap<Character,Boolean>());
  55     }
  56 
  57     private static void put(Map<Character,Boolean> m,
  58                             Character key, Boolean value,
  59                             Boolean oldValue) {
  60         if (oldValue != null) {
  61             check("containsValue(oldValue)", m.containsValue(oldValue));
  62             check("values.contains(oldValue)", m.values().contains(oldValue));
  63         }
  64         equal(m.put(key, value), oldValue);
  65         equal(m.get(key), value);
  66         check("containsKey", m.containsKey(key));
  67         check("keySet.contains", m.keySet().contains(key));
  68         check("containsValue", m.containsValue(value));
  69         check("values.contains",  m.values().contains(value));
  70         check("!isEmpty", ! m.isEmpty());
  71     }
  72 
  73     private static void testMap(Map<Character,Boolean> m) {
  74         // We verify following assertions in get(Object) method javadocs
  75         boolean permitsNullKeys = (! (m instanceof ConcurrentMap ||
  76                                       m instanceof Hashtable     ||
  77                                       m instanceof SortedMap));
  78         boolean permitsNullValues = (! (m instanceof ConcurrentMap ||
  79                                         m instanceof Hashtable));
  80         boolean usesIdentity = m instanceof IdentityHashMap;
  81 
  82         System.err.println(m.getClass());
  83         put(m, 'A', true,  null);
  84         put(m, 'A', false, true);       // Guaranteed identical by JLS
  85         put(m, 'B', true,  null);
  86         put(m, new Character('A'), false, usesIdentity ? null : false);
  87         if (permitsNullKeys) {
  88             try {
  89                 put(m, null, true,  null);
  90                 put(m, null, false, true);
  91             }
  92             catch (Throwable t) { unexpected(m.getClass().getName(), t); }
  93         } else {
  94             try { m.get(null); fail(m.getClass().getName() + " did not reject null key"); }
  95             catch (NullPointerException e) {}
  96             catch (Throwable t) { unexpected(m.getClass().getName(), t); }
  97 
  98             try { m.put(null, true); fail(m.getClass().getName() + " did not reject null key"); }
  99             catch (NullPointerException e) {}
 100             catch (Throwable t) { unexpected(m.getClass().getName(), t); }
 101         }
 102         if (permitsNullValues) {
 103             try {
 104                 put(m, 'C', null, null);
 105                 put(m, 'C', true, null);
 106                 put(m, 'C', null, true);
 107             }
 108             catch (Throwable t) { unexpected(m.getClass().getName(), t); }
 109         } else {
 110             try { m.put('A', null); fail(m.getClass().getName() + " did not reject null key"); }
 111             catch (NullPointerException e) {}
 112             catch (Throwable t) { unexpected(m.getClass().getName(), t); }
 113 
 114             try { m.put('C', null); fail(m.getClass().getName() + " did not reject null key"); }
 115             catch (NullPointerException e) {}
 116             catch (Throwable t) { unexpected(m.getClass().getName(), t); }
 117         }
 118     }
